Description

This is a combined synopsis/solicitation for commercial products and commercial services prepared in accordance with the format in Revolutionary FAR Overhaul (RFO) subpart 12.202, Publicizing, as supplemented with additional information included in this notice. This announcement constitutes the only solicitation. This solicitation is issued as an RFQ.? The solicitation document and incorporated provisions and clauses are those in effect through Federal Acquisition Circular 2026-01. Department of Veterans Affairs (VA) Network Contracting Office (NCO 10) has a requirement for: Smoke and Fire Damper Inspections buildings 302, 310, 320, 330, 340, 350 and 410 at the Dayton VA Medical Center. This RFQ is set-aside for SDVOSB vendors who are certified at SAM.gov. All vendors shall be properly registered in the System for Award Management (SAM) database. The Associated North American Industrial Classification System code for this procurement is 541350, Building Inspection Services, with a small business size standard of $11.5 Million. The Produce Service Code for this procurement is H312, Inspection Fire Control Equipment.
